--- Comment #51 from lightside <lightside@gmx.com> ---
(In reply to comment #49)
> With the upcoming release of 11.0 we also need to add a small adjustment =
to RtAudio.cpp.
>
> This updated patch adds the following to the previous 2.0.4.1 update to t=
he
> end of files/patch-drivers_rtaudio_RtAudio.cpp. sampleRate is an unsigned=
 int
> so srate gets promoted to unsigned int, this means the result is always
> positive so the use of abs() is of no use.

I think, that your logic about srate is wrong, because srate defined as int:
https://github.com/godotengine/godot/blob/820dd1d0016763cda6177104e66e09c86=
34150be/drivers/rtaudio/RtAudio.cpp#L9018
I placed following debug code near your patched place:
printf("srate=3D%d, sampleRate=3D%d, srate - sampleRate =3D %d, abs(srate -
sampleRate) =3D %d\n", srate, sampleRate, srate - sampleRate, abs(srate -
sampleRate));
with following output:
srate=3D44100, sampleRate=3D44100, srate - sampleRate =3D 0, abs(srate - sa=
mpleRate)
=3D 0

But there are other possible cases, where abs is needed.
-8<--
#include <stdio.h>
#include <stdlib.h>

int check(int a, unsigned int b)
{
        return (a - b) > 100;
}

int check_abs(int a, unsigned int b)
{
        return abs(a - b) > 100;
}

int main()
{
        unsigned int c =3D 44200;
        for (int i =3D 44100; i <=3D 44300; i +=3D 100)
                printf("check(%d, %d) =3D %d; check_abs(%d, %d) =3D %d\n", =
i, c,
check(i, c), i, c, check_abs(i, c));

        return 0;
}
-->8-
% c++ test.cpp -o test && ./test
check(44100, 44200) =3D 1; check_abs(44100, 44200) =3D 0
check(44200, 44200) =3D 0; check_abs(44200, 44200) =3D 0
check(44300, 44200) =3D 0; check_abs(44300, 44200) =3D 0

Without abs, the first case is wrong, i.e. possible srate =3D 44100 and
sampleRate =3D 44200.
